Разкодировать скрипты закодированные Zend Encoder-ом

savagex

New member
Joined
May 19, 2005
Messages
1
Reaction score
0
Есть ли в природе декодер для скриптов закодированных Zend Encoder-ом и если есть, то где его взять ? ;)
 
S

satirik

я конечно могу ошибаться, но мне кажеться это нереально.
Вряд ли ты найдешь такую софтину. Наверно ее просто нет :)
 

Klaus

Social Engineer
Joined
Jan 9, 2020
Messages
1,654
Reaction score
79
savagex, раскодирвать зенд невозможно.
есть другие алгиртмы которые поддаются либо нулению либо раскодированию.
 

Garrett

Member
Joined
Jun 5, 2004
Messages
5
Reaction score
0
Klaus said:
savagex, раскодирвать зенд невозможно.
есть другие алгиртмы которые поддаются либо нулению либо раскодированию.
В смысле? Получается, что ioncube и/или SourceGuardian все-таки ломаются? Как? Руками или на автомате?
 

Klaus

Social Engineer
Joined
Jan 9, 2020
Messages
1,654
Reaction score
79
SourceGuardian можно раскодировать, насчёт ioncub'a точно не знаю.
 

Garrett

Member
Joined
Jun 5, 2004
Messages
5
Reaction score
0
ммм... а не знаешь, как идет сам процесс реверсинга? байт-код из памяти дергают или еще как-нить?
 

mistake

New member
Joined
Sep 23, 2004
Messages
2
Reaction score
0
Какое-то время тому назад (с полгода?) читал на http://phpclub.ru/talk/ разоблачительную статью о Zend Safeguard (он мол типа - мыльный пузырь). Сейчас найти не смог. Можете попытаться найти сами.
 

paganelp

Member
Joined
Dec 10, 2004
Messages
6
Reaction score
0
mistake said:
Какое-то время тому назад (с полгода?) читал на http://phpclub.ru/talk/ разоблачительную статью о Zend Safeguard (он мол типа - мыльный пузырь). Сейчас найти не смог. Можете попытаться найти сами.
Да, именно там было такое обсуждение. Попробуй поискать по инету. Там, если память не изменяет, даже какие-то выкладки были (программные)
 

demagog1

Member
Joined
Oct 13, 2004
Messages
24
Reaction score
2
В статье описывалось, что привязки Zend к IP адресам и времени работы - фуфло полное, показано на примерах как обходить защиту.
Поэтому если человеку интересно, что там такого оригинального написано в скрипте или просто дописать нужную фичу в имеющейся скрипт - это совсем другая песня... Никем еще для Zend'a не написанная.
 

Klaus

Social Engineer
Joined
Jan 9, 2020
Messages
1,654
Reaction score
79
байт-код из памяти дергают или еще как-нить?
точно не знаю, но с sg всё происходит гораздо проще.
 

El magnifico

Member
Joined
Mar 30, 2004
Messages
21
Reaction score
0
Scan said:
Лохотрон очередной...
я бы не стал заходить так долеко и без должных доказательств так говорить, эта тема активно обсуждалась на http://www.wmtrader.com/forum/
и там люди приводили значительные доводы по этому поводу.
советую перед тем как высказыватся - хотябы немного понимать суть вопроса
 

Klaus

Social Engineer
Joined
Jan 9, 2020
Messages
1,654
Reaction score
79
Scan, ошибаешся, я видел реальные результы декодирования. правда не конкретно этого сервиса, но саму возможности декодирования, на данный момент, отрицать не стоит.
 
Last edited by a moderator:

Scan

Member
Joined
Mar 11, 2004
Messages
37
Reaction score
5
El magnifico said:
я бы не стал заходить так долеко и без должных доказательств так говорить, эта тема активно обсуждалась на http://www.wmtrader.com/forum/
и там люди приводили значительные доводы по этому поводу.
советую перед тем как высказыватся - хотябы немного понимать суть вопроса
;) если ты внимательно глянеш на мой ник, а потом на ники в теме в форуме на вмтрейдере, то ты поймешь, что к чему, и что я не просто так говорю.. :) И суть вопроса я понимаю ;) А результат.. Кхм.. Не верю без доказательств :)
 

serge_bl

Member
Joined
Sep 13, 2005
Messages
5
Reaction score
0
Господа, а подскажите пожалуйста - судя по всему, вы не по наслышке знаете, что такое Zend Encoder...
Есть опыт кодирования этим кодером?
Насколько я понимаю, обязательно наличие на сервере раскодировщика? Если несколько раз закодировать один и тот же скрипт - содержимое (бинарники) будут отличаться?
И ещё - попытки запаковать закодированный скрипт архиватором - дают высокий процент сжатия?

P.S. сорри за чайниковские вопросы - я абсолютный ноль, но очень любопытный ;-))
 

Vic'er

Member
Joined
Nov 29, 2003
Messages
45
Reaction score
1
>>Насколько я понимаю, обязательно наличие на сервере раскодировщика?
да, он бесплатный, взять его можна на оффсайте. только он не "раскодировщик" а преобразователь бинарного кода

>>Если несколько раз закодировать один и тот же скрипт - содержимое (бинарники) будут отличаться?
Zend Encoder компилит PHP скрипт в бинарный код, который обрабатывается серваком. двойного кодирования не может быть в принципе.

>> попытки запаковать закодированный скрипт архиватором - дают высокий процент сжатия?
не понял - зачем?
 

syva

Member
Joined
Dec 9, 2003
Messages
25
Reaction score
1
>>Если несколько раз закодировать один и тот же скрипт - содержимое (бинарники) будут отличаться?
нет не будут -совпадут байт в байт

>> попытки запаковать закодированный скрипт архиватором - дают высокий процент сжатия?
вообще не дают (или порядка одно процента) уменьшение размера возможно только за счет функции "непрерывного архива" в раре
 

serge_bl

Member
Joined
Sep 13, 2005
Messages
5
Reaction score
0
Vic'er said:
>>Насколько я понимаю, обязательно наличие на сервере раскодировщика?
только он не "раскодировщик" а преобразователь бинарного кода
ну, это, конечно, резко меняет дело... ;-)))

>>Если несколько раз закодировать один и тот же скрипт - содержимое (бинарники) будут отличаться?
Zend Encoder компилит PHP скрипт в бинарный код, который обрабатывается серваком. двойного кодирования не может быть в принципе.
вы не поняли мой вопрос - впрочем, следующий автор правильно меня понял и уже ответил.
я имел в виду - перекодировать ДВАЖДЫ один и тот же ИСХОДНЫЙ текст.

>> попытки запаковать закодированный скрипт архиватором - дают высокий процент сжатия?
не понял - зачем?
А зачем вы вопросом на вопрос отвечаете? ;-)))

А для того, чтобы оценить качество шифрования. Есть такая штука, называется избыточность кода. Плохие методы шифрования (замена по таблице, например, или xor) не устраняют её. А хорошие - устраняют.
 
Last edited by a moderator:

serge_bl

Member
Joined
Sep 13, 2005
Messages
5
Reaction score
0
Прежде всего - спасибо за ответ.

syva said:
>>Если несколько раз закодировать один и тот же скрипт - содержимое (бинарники) будут отличаться?
нет не будут -совпадут байт в байт
Это хорошо.
И, насколько я понимаю, размер при этом уменьшается.

>> попытки запаковать закодированный скрипт архиватором - дают высокий процент сжатия?
вообще не дают (или порядка одно процента) уменьшение размера возможно только за счет функции "непрерывного архива" в раре
ясно. А вот это очень плохо. Значит используется серьёзный алгоритм шифрации...

Спасибо всем ответившим.
 
Top